Description
JOB TITLE:
Home Care Registered Nurse
FUNCTION
Provides nursing care to Hospice of the Upstate patients in accordance to Medicare Conditions of Participation and organizational policies following medical directives and Hospice plan of care
SUPERVISION RECEIVED
Works under minimal supervision while ensuring quality health care. Reports to the Home Care Patient Care Coordinator.
SUPERVISION EXERCISED
The RN will provide supervision to Hospice Aides and Licensed Practical Nurses with jointly assigned patients.
QUALFICATIONS
1. Must have a current South Carolina license as a Registered Nurse.
2. Must have a valid driver's license and proof of automobile insurance.
3. Must have reliable transportation.
4. Demonstrate the ability to be flexible and work indendently.
5. Demonstrate the ability to manage work load and schedule effectively and efficiently.
6. Must be empathetic and have the ability to relate well to patients, families, and members of the Hospice of the Upstate care team.
7. Understands and embraces the hospice philosophy.

PHYSICAL DEMANDS
May be required to climb steps, stoop, bend or lift up to 35 pounds. Must be able to communicate compassionately with patients, families and the general public.
